Despair among men is already a global epidemic and increasing at an alarming rate. Even high-functioning “successful” men succumb to substance abuse and even suicide. In fact, 80% of suicides are men. Without the permission, tools, or role models, men don’t talk about their feelings. Focused on addressing the silent epidemic of male despair, this show engages in heartfelt discussions about the isolation and loneliness many men experience, often hidden behind a facade of happiness. The co-hosts, who share their own journeys through trauma, anxiety, and depression, frequently highlight the importance of community, vulnerability, and genuine connections. Episodes cover a wide range of topics including mental health, emotional expression, and societal expectations of masculinity, with expert insights from a psychiatrist that enrich the conversation. By encouraging open dialogue and the sharing of personal stories, the content seeks to foster a sense of belonging and promote mental wellness among male listeners.
